360 Geo - Andalusia to the sound of guitars and flamenco (2018)
A beautiful report on Andalusia, Flamenco, the magnificent Granada capital of guitar and lutherie. But very beautiful in Granada, sorry but he is French!
We can see among others Alvaro Martinete, Francisco Diaz Manuel, Victor Diaz, Amparo Heredia, Marcos Palometas and especially Granada the magnificent.

Excellent documentary. I had the pleasure of meeting and watching Alvaro at work this July in Sanlucar, fantastic player. And Amparo I have accompanied dozens of times here in USA. She and her sister Raquel, who dances, are from Malaga, relatives of Repompa.

Thanks for posting this. It’s beautifully filmed.

I really like Francesco Manuel Diaz, I visit his shop every time I am in Granada and last saw him in August. The film captures his character very well.

And the film was also a good introduction to Álvaro Martinete (for me). I notice he released an album last year, “Seis Veredas”, which is available on Apple music. I haven’t had a chance to listen to it yet, but I’m looking forward to doing so.
